Maison  >  Article  >  base de données  >  La différence entre MySQL et MongoDB

La différence entre MySQL et MongoDB

WBOY
WBOYavant
2023-09-18 15:05:02924parcourir

MySQL 和 MongoDB 的区别

MySQL est une base de données relationnelle. MongoDB est une base de données NoSQL.

Voici les différences importantes entre MySQL et MongoDB.

tr>
Avancé. Non. Keys MySQL MongoDB
1 Propriétaire/Développeur MySQL appartient à Oracle. MongoDB est développé par MongoDB Inc.
2 Stockage de données MySql stocke les données au format tabulaire sous forme d'enregistrements dans un tableau. MongoDB stocke les enregistrements sous forme de documents.
3 Language SQL, Structured Query Language est utilisé pour interroger la base de données. Mode dynamique. Définissez des structures prédéfinies pour les données entrantes.
4 Objectif de conception Aucune réplication et partitionnement efficaces disponibles. Haute disponibilité, évolutivité, réplication et partitionnement intégrés.
5 Terms MongoDB utilise Collection, Document, Champ, Document intégré, liaison, etc. MySQL utilise Table, Ligne, Colonne, Jointure, etc.
6 Stockage de données MySQL stocke les données au format d'enregistrement de table. MongoDB stocke les données sous forme JSON de type document.

Ce qui précède est le contenu détaillé de. pour plus d'informations, suivez d'autres articles connexes sur le site Web de PHP en chinois!

Déclaration:
Cet article est reproduit dans:. en cas de violation, veuillez contacter admin@php.cn Supprimer